To start with, download the latest version of ubuntu for the beaglebone black. Nelson kindly provides a 2weekly build of a complete debian with machinekit image for a beaglebone black white. Building buildroot image for beaglebone black using ubuntu. I would like to reduce the overhead required by ubuntu. Instructions in this post are still relevant if you have an older image. It seems that qemu is the only emulator that supports linux emulation for arm. Since much of this page is generic, it has also been extended to help support devices such as the pandaboard and beaglebone. Gaming cape transform your beaglebone into a full fledged handheld gaming console. To boot from microsd, youll need to hold down the userboot button located near the microsd end of the board while poweringon the device. After trying for hours to get a basic gps working on angstrom, we decided that it was not worth it.
Writing a new image to the beaglebone black derekmolloy. Beaglebone black ubuntu installation mgaggerobeaglebone. To compile the linux kernel for the beaglebone black, you must first have an arm cross compiler installed. Official ubuntu core kernel release for beaglebone black. After that, you can simply insert the sd card into the beaglebone black and your board should be visible within wyliodrin studio. Boot bbb with the installed prebuilt image from emmc. Ubuntu snappy core on beaglebone black rev c testing ubuntu snappy on the beaglebone black rev c following the instructions. Select the drive that represents your sd card or usb sd card. Is there anyone who could give feedback on using the beaglebone image thus far. Beaglebone black the beaglebone black board has the same processor but slightly different specs.
Debian, angstrom distribution, ubuntu, archlinux, gentoo. Angstrom angstrom is the default linux distribution that is preinstalled on the emmc on the beaglebone black. Yet, as a ta and software engineer i am frequently asked a question regarding the beaglebone black. First, youll want to download the usd card image from. To do this download the image, unzip it, and use a disk flasher or the command line to flash the image. Apr 21, 2014 getting started with opencv on the beaglebone black with ubuntu 14. Tools and techniques for building with embedded linux by derek molloy. While holding down the boot button, apply power to the board. Beaglebone black software image update instruction. The steps described in this guide are pretty much platform agnostic. Installing ubuntu onto beaglebone black timothys default ubuntu configuration from mac os x image microsd card. Once your beaglebone black is powered up and running you can now move to your computer or laptop so you can ssh into it, open a terminal and connect to it. I am trying to install ubuntu core 16 on the beaglebone black, which is supposedly supported. Ubuntu on beaglebone black be merged into this page.
These are packages that need to be installed on top of your selected windows manager and an nf needed to correctly setup the video interface. Beaglebone black preparing to run debian or ubuntu from. I also dont see a beaglebone black image for download. I followed the instructions on this page beagleboard. This will download the disc image for your sd card straight to your computer. This is just a quick post to detail some observations that i have had in case they are useful to others in writing a new image to the beaglebone black. Download the latest firmware for your beagleboard, beagleboardxm, beagleboardx15, beaglebone, beaglebone black, beaglebone black wireless, beaglebone ai, beaglebone blue, seeedstudio beaglebone green, seeedstudio beaglebone green wireless, sancloud beaglebone enhanced, element14 beaglebone black industrial, arrow beaglebone black. If youve used the the image to flash ubuntu to the emmc, the default username. We also decided to use a different image on the beaglebone.
If using beaglebone black, beaglebone blue, beaglebone ai or other board. Also, i mentioned that the rfs could be built from scratch using a utility called busybox. This page is about running a linux distribution arm eabi ubuntu on the beagleboard. After you have put the beagebone black ubuntu flasher image on a micro sd card, insert it into the poweredoff bbb. I have setup eclipse according to the video and managed to cross compile a simple hello world program in c and launching it on the beaglebone black. Now i have managed to copy an image to the micros card after i. So for now i rebuilt my test images for the beagle board instead of bone and it actually boots with the latest qemulinaro. In this post, well see, how to create a custom rfs using busybox and what are all the additional files required to boot the kernel. Hi, i have a beaglebone black board and want to load ubuntu on it. Jun 26, 2018 installing ubuntu on your new beaglebone black rev. Once the image downloaded and unziped, the only thing that you have to do is to flash it. Black, beaglebone black wireless, beaglebone ai, beaglebone blue.
At the time of this writing the current version is 4. Some general help on programming sd cards can be found on the ubuntu image writer page. Im yet to install and test it, but wanted to get a basic idea of. Major process underway, testing the system in a powered model airplane now. I flashed it using a guide to flashing a prebuilt image to emmc. Custom rfs for beaglebone black using busybox embedjournal. Download the latest firmware for your beagleboard, beagleboardxm. Currently i have ubuntu installed on my beaglebone which i am accessing through hyperterminal. Choose the starting point you want, download or produce the sd card image and follow the steps above. The site structures and contains all of the digital media that is described in the book.
Howto create a custom microsd card image for the beaglebone. Ubuntu precise on a micro sd card to boot your beaglebone black from. Since i covered debian on the pocketbeagle we can look at ubuntu 18. I created this guide because many of the guides and instructions are scattered across many places and i wanted a concise place to reference. Minimal ubuntu install for beaglebone black stack overflow. Ive got my hands on a beaglebone, and the first thing i did was installing the latest ubuntu 12. The kernel is compiled from the mainline linux kernel git repository. Getting started with opencv on the beaglebone black with ubuntu 14. Download to start with, download the latest version of ubuntu for the beaglebone black. Jul 15, 2017 hi, im new to beaglebone black and wanted to know if anyone can help me on installing ubuntu 16. Beaglebone black preparing to run debian or ubuntu from the microsd card. Beagleboard will boot the arm eabi ubuntu distribution from the sd card. Flashinginstalling ubuntu on your beaglebone black. Insert sd card and hold down the sd card boot button on the beaglebone black host.
Ubuntu on beaglebone black and copied the image onto a microsd card, but because i do not have a computer monitor and keyboard that can work with the bbb, i am wondering now how i can accessverify the linux on the bbb. This is the companion site for the book exploring beaglebone. You will need to connect your beaglebone black to your network and power it on. Read the stepbystep getting started tutorial below to begin developing with your beaglebone black in minutes. However, i have difficulties accessing the gpios of the beaglebone black using eclipse, and i need to use pwms on the gpios as well.
The last major instructable i posted was the rc glider drone. The linux distribution depends on the board version. Getting the ubuntu image download the latest software image. Select the drive that represents your sd card or usb sd card adapter. Getting started with opencv on the beaglebone black with. This makes bbbandroid a great choice for hobbyists, students, and professionals that wish to experiment with hardware interfacing. These steps will probably also work on the beagleboard. The beaglebone black will try to boot the internal angstrom image by default. Optionally, download and install the latest kernel. In ubuntu terminal, do ls dev to note the inserted device name.
Hello folks, in my previous post on linux kernel compilation for beaglebone black, i had used prebuilt rfs for booting the kernel. Download the latest firmware for your beagleboard, beagleboardxm, beagleboardx15, beaglebone, beaglebone black, beaglebone black wireless, beaglebone ai, beaglebone blue, seeedstudio beaglebone green, seeedstudio beaglebone green wireless, sancloud beaglebone enhanced, element14 beaglebone black industrial, arrow beaglebone black industrial, mentorel. Beagle boards are tiny computers with all the capability of todays desktop machines, without the bulk, expense, or noise. One could also adjust them to other systems, besides the beaglebone black. How to flash beaglebone black wireless emmc with ubuntu 18. May 19, 2014 read about beaglebone black software image update instruction on. If you have any doubt at all about this software or linix, do not download. I cant seem to find the documentation on how to utilise the beagleblack gadget snap. Open etcher and select the downloaded bbb image file. If you are running something other than ubuntu, the links following the wget. Hi, im new to beaglebone black and wanted to know if anyone can help me on installing ubuntu 16.
Beaglebone black ships from the factory with linux installed on the boards emmc memory and with an empty microsd card slot, which you can use to install debian. I managed to update the image to debian jessie but the onboard storage is only 4gb and wanted to install ros, opencv and qt 5. This section shows you how to flash ubuntu onto the emmc of your beaglebone black. Ubuntu on beagle run ubuntu linux distribution on your beaglebone black. These scripts prepare the microsd card for running the os directly from the card, not for. Oct 11, 2012 ive got my hands on a beaglebone, and the first thing i did was installing the latest ubuntu 12. Does anyone know how to get the gui up and running in beaglebone. This sections assumes you have already installed your favorite xorg based window manager, such as lxde, xfce, kde, gnome, etc. As many of you may know i am writing an introductory book on linux and programming. Were going to start with a known good angstrom image and then updatereplace some of the files to add the wl18xx support. Use either the ubuntu image writer or instructions on its page to write the decompressed image to your sd card.
What are the easiest ways to reduce the overhead of ubuntu for the beaglebone black. What are the easiest ways to reduce the overhead of ubuntu for the. Because ive been doing more and more with my beaglebone black, i decided to adopt those raspbian scripts to similarly prepare a fresh microsd card for use in a bbb. Also make sure you have a keyboard, mouse, display, and ethernet connected. Step 2 boot into ubuntu insert the microsdhc card into the beaglebone black. Backup and restore your beaglebone black linux propaganda. This post is mainly for selfdocumenting, feel free to follow my footsteps at your own risk.
Writing a new image to the beaglebone black previous next updated april 2015 although the bbb is supplied with a linux distribution already on its emmc, one of the first steps you may carry out is updating your bbb to have the latest linux distribution. I am trying to install ubuntu in beaglebone but ubuntu desktop environment wonts came. This is a quick guide to get you up and running with ubuntu on your beaglebone black. Instead, you may be interested in an updated post how to flash beaglebone black wireless emmc with ubuntu 18. C is rather simple and only takes a few minutes to get up and running. The result is an easytoinstall and stable linux image that works with both the beaglebone and the beaglebone black boards. The latest ubuntu image for beaglebone black available is 14. In the meantime, i would like to post the progress i have made with the beaglebone. Download the latest firmware for your beagleboard, beagleboardxm, beagleboardx15, beaglebone, beaglebone black, beaglebone black. This longtermsupport lts ubuntu version enables you to install lts versions of several software, for example, robotics middleware ros. It can be used a common web browser like firefox or chrome or, from a linux or macos x terminal. Alternatively, the direct download link for this image is here. Installing ubuntu on your new beaglebone black rev. Download to start with, download the latest version of ubuntu for the.
Download the lastest debian image from latestimages. Beaglebone black at digikey beaglebone green at digikey embest beaglebone black at digikey beaglebone black wireless at digikey beaglebone green wireless at digikey. You need to install the dependencies for buildroot. In this post, well see, how to create a custom rfs using. The following contains instructions for building the beaglebone black kernel on ubuntu 15. The beaglebone black has 2gb of emmc storage that can be initialized by.
This validation used the 20620 4gb sd card image for beaglebone black. This article serves as a guide on how to create a custom microsd card image for the beaglebone black. Run ubuntu linux distribution on your beaglebone black. The result is an easytoinstall and stable linux image that works with both the beaglebone and the beaglebone black. How do i install ubuntu core 16 on the beaglebone black. Ubuntu is an unsupported operating system for the beaglebone black bbb, but does have quite a few users, and a stable image with the 3. At the time of release, not all of these distributions support beaglebone black, but should soon. Both have the same ram, hdmi out, and ethernet, but the beaglebone black has superior io more and faster and has a faster processor capable of running ubuntu, where the raspberry pi cannot due to its older architecture.